Analysis

In 2050, manure applied to soils — direct emissions in Northern Africa stood at 2.59 kt.

Over the whole period, manure applied to soils — direct emissions in Northern Africa peaked at 3.59 kt in 2010 and was at its lowest, 0.7261 kt, in 1962.

Northern Africa ranks 29th of 32 groups on this measure, in the bottom quarter.

The long-run direction has been consistently rising across the 65 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
